Custom enamel pins are personalized metal pins that come in a variety of styles, shapes, and colors. They are usually made from two types of enamel: soft enamel and hard enamel. The difference lies in the finish: soft enamel pins have a rough surface, while hard enamel pins have a smooth, polished surface.
These pins are made by combining durable metals such as iron, brass, and zinc alloy with vibrant enamel colors. The ability to create pins to your specific preferences makes custom enamel pins very versatile, suitable for personal, corporate, or creative use.
